BERLIN, Md. — The Maryland State Police Berlin Barrack is experiencing temporary disruptions to its non-emergency phone service after a traffic incident damaged local telephone lines, officials announced. According to a statement released by the barrack, emergency 911 services remain fully operational and are continuing to receive calls without interruption.
